Katy Perry Will get Superior 'American Idol' Tribute on Her Last Episode




Katy Perry got a sweet sendoff on the TV show she’s been on for 7 years — with “American Idol” paying tribute to her by having the remaining contestants sing a bunch of her songs.

The pop star showed up on ‘Idol’ Sunday night for the season finale … and before they announced the winner (Abi Carter), Ryan Seacrest and co. gave KP her own special moment in the broadcast … and of course, it included music.

The ‘Idol’ producers brought back the Top 12 girls — several of whom had already been eliminated, but only appeared for this highlight — to belt out a medley of Katy’s biggest songs … including “Teenage Dream,” “Dark Horse” and “California Girls.”

As you can imagine … it made for an awesome performance — both in-person and on TV — with all the ladies harmonizing as they hop-scotched their way through Katy’s most iconic hits.

Katy herself looked on from the judge’s table … and once the tribute wrapped, she gave a big round of applause — and even hopped up on the table itself to show her approval.
